19 words & definitions
| gumption |
Having spirited initiative and resourcefulness
|
| moxie |
Force of character, determination, or nerve
|
| verve |
Vigor and spirit or enthusiasm
|
| spunky |
Courageous and determined
|
| maverick |
An unorthodox or independent-minded person
|
| plucky |
Having or showing determined courage in the face of difficulties
|
| audacious |
To be very confident and daring : very bold and surprising or shocking
|
| gutsy |
Showing courage, determination, and spirit
|
| bravado |
A bold manner or a show of boldness intended to impress or intimidate
|
| valor |
Great courage in the face of danger, especially in battle
|
| valiant |
Possessing or showing courage or determination
|
| gallant |
Brave, heroic.
|
| warrior |
A person with courage and the inclination to fight and win
|
| daring |
Willing to take risks; brave or bold.
|
| embolden |
To give someone the courage or confidence to do something.
|
| mettle |
Strength of character — showing resilience and spirit.
|
| savior |
Someone who comes to the aid of others, improving their circumstances or offering a solution to a problem.
|
| adventurous |
Willing to take risks to try new and difficult methods, ideas, or experiences.
|
| intrepid |
Extremely brave and showing no fear of dangerous situations
|
